Mercury was a mid-priced automobile brand created by Ford Motor Company to sit between Ford and Lincoln. It operated from 1939 to 2011, producing sedans, coupes, wagons, and SUVs. Mercury often shared platforms with Ford and Lincoln, but was marketed as a more premium alternative to Ford. Over time it became known for models like the Cougar, Grand Marquis, and Sable before being discontinued in 2010.
